Clemson HC Dabo Swinney loses CB to transfer portal after rough start
Clemson Tigers' head coach Dabo Swinney faces a setback as cornerback Shelton Lewis enters the transfer portal after a challenging start to the 2025 season. Lewis's decision to redshirt this year and seek new opportunities highlights the ongoing challenges within college football programs, especially during tough seasons. This move could impact the team's defensive strategy moving forward, making it a significant development for fans and analysts alike.

Ty Simpson’s gladiators take after Georgia upset win
PositiveSports
Alabama football pulled off an impressive upset against No. 10 Georgia, winning 24-21, largely thanks to quarterback Ty Simpson's standout performance. He completed 24 of 38 passes for 276 yards and two touchdowns, while also rushing for a touchdown. This victory is significant as it showcases Alabama's resilience and skill, potentially shifting the dynamics in college football rankings and boosting team morale.

Duke, Jon Scheyer agree to 6-year contract
PositiveSports
Duke University's basketball team has secured its future by signing head coach Jon Scheyer to a six-year contract extension, ensuring he will lead the team until 2031. This move is significant as Scheyer, who succeeded the legendary Mike Krzyzewski, is seen as a key figure in maintaining the team's competitive edge in NCAA basketball. The extension reflects the university's confidence in Scheyer's leadership and vision for the program.
Plans for 76-team NCAA Tournament expansion revealed
PositiveSports
Exciting news for college basketball fans as plans for a 76-team NCAA Tournament expansion have been revealed, potentially starting in 2026. NCAA president Charlie Baker is optimistic about this change, which could bring even more thrilling moments to March Madness. This expansion aims to enhance the tournament's competitiveness and inclusivity, allowing more teams to participate and fans to enjoy a broader range of matchups. It's a significant shift that could reshape the landscape of college basketball, making it even more engaging for fans and players alike.
